    Quote Originally Posted by Rater202 View Post
    Quote Originally Posted by LaZodiac View Post
    That is not what warlock means. It comes from a permutation of old englis, Waerloga, and receives nuance from the Scots language. At most it means someone in league with {scrub the post, scrub the quote}, not about them being nasty men who betray everyone in general.
    Actually, no, there's an older meaning than that.

    The earliest traces for waerloga suggest that it is a combination of wǣr, "covenant" and lēogan, "to deny." Thus, "denier of the covenant" but this wasn't referring to {scrub the post, scrub the quote}, it was just a generic term for traitors, liars, and scoundrels.

    However, it was also used euphemistically to refer to {scrub the post, scrub the quote}.

    {scrub the post, scrub the quote}, but the oldest use and literal meaning of the word boil down to "breaker of oaths and pacts."
